I should probably explain at this point, for those who do not regularly watch this show, that the X Factor is a singing competition! Contestants audition for a place in the live finals where the public have the chance to vote for their favourites. The least favourites each week have a sing-off and the judges, Simon Cowell, Danni, Cheryl and Louis then get to choose which one to keep and which one to send home. At the end of the show, there is one winner who is crowned as having the X Factor and given a record deal from BMI, the recording label that Simon Cowell works for.
